btrfs: fix copying the flags of btrfs_bio after split
When a btrfs_bio gets split, only 'bbio->csum_search_commit_root' gets
copied to the new btrfs_bio, all the other flags don't.
When a bio is split in btrfs_submit_chunk(), btrfs_split_bio() creates
the new split bio via btrfs_bio_init() which zeroes the struct with
memset. Looking at btrfs_split_bio(), it copies csum_search_commit_root
from the original but does not copy can_use_append.
After the split, the code does:
bbio = split;
bio = &bbio->bio;
This means the split bio (with can_use_append = false) gets submitted,
not the original. In btrfs_submit_dev_bio(), the condition:
if (btrfs_bio(bio)->can_use_append && btrfs_dev_is_sequential(...))
Will be false for the split bio even when writing to a sequential zone.
Does the split bio need to inherit can_use_append from the original? The
old code used a local variable use_append which persisted across the
split.
Copy the rest of the flags as well.
